The sixth season of Kamp Van Koningsbrugge takes place in the jungle of Suriname. For the first time, the program is being recorded outside of Europe. Fifteen participants will undergo rigorous training under commando conditions, AVROTROS reported on Monday.
The Surinamese jungle is an official training location for the Dutch armed forces. According to the broadcaster, the tropical climate, dense vegetation, and natural hazards will put extra physical and mental pressure on the candidates.
The recordings were made in collaboration with the Surinamese army, local authorities, a Surinamese crew, and the population.
In the program, participants’ physical and mental endurance is tested during intensive training based on that of the Defense elite unit. The program is presented by Jeroen van Koningsbrugge. Former commandos Ray Klaassens and Dai Carter are also involved in the program.
The first episode of the new season can be seen on NPO 1 on Monday, September 1st at 8:30 PM.
